Top 10 Programming Languages to Learn in 2021

Are you ready to take your programming skills to the next level? Do you want to stay ahead of the curve and learn the most in-demand programming languages of 2021? Look no further! In this article, we will explore the top 10 programming languages to learn in 2021.

1. Python

Python has been one of the most popular programming languages for several years now, and it shows no signs of slowing down. It is a versatile language that can be used for web development, data analysis, machine learning, and more. Python's popularity is due to its simplicity, readability, and vast community support. It is an excellent language for beginners and experts alike.

2. JavaScript

JavaScript is the language of the web. It is used for front-end development, back-end development, and everything in between. JavaScript has evolved significantly over the years, and it is now one of the most powerful and versatile programming languages. It is an essential language for anyone interested in web development.

3. Java

Java is a popular language for enterprise development. It is used for building large-scale applications, such as banking systems, e-commerce platforms, and more. Java is known for its robustness, scalability, and security. It is an excellent language for anyone interested in enterprise development.

4. TypeScript

TypeScript is a superset of JavaScript that adds static typing to the language. It is becoming increasingly popular in the web development community, especially with the rise of front-end frameworks like Angular and React. TypeScript makes it easier to write and maintain large-scale JavaScript applications.

5. Kotlin

Kotlin is a modern programming language that runs on the Java Virtual Machine (JVM). It is becoming increasingly popular for Android development, as it offers many advantages over Java, such as null safety, extension functions, and more. Kotlin is an excellent language for anyone interested in Android development.

6. Swift

Swift is a programming language developed by Apple for iOS, macOS, watchOS, and tvOS development. It is a fast and efficient language that is easy to learn. Swift has gained popularity in recent years, and it is an excellent language for anyone interested in iOS development.

7. Go

Go is a programming language developed by Google. It is designed for building scalable and efficient applications. Go is becoming increasingly popular for building microservices and cloud-native applications. It is an excellent language for anyone interested in cloud-native development.

8. Rust

Rust is a systems programming language that is designed for safety, speed, and concurrency. It is becoming increasingly popular for building high-performance applications, such as web browsers, game engines, and more. Rust is an excellent language for anyone interested in systems programming.

9. C#

C# is a programming language developed by Microsoft. It is used for building Windows applications, web applications, and games. C# is known for its simplicity, readability, and performance. It is an excellent language for anyone interested in Windows development.

10. PHP

PHP is a server-side scripting language that is used for building dynamic web applications. It is one of the most popular programming languages for web development, and it is used by many popular websites, such as Facebook and WordPress. PHP is an excellent language for anyone interested in web development.

Conclusion

There you have it, the top 10 programming languages to learn in 2021. Whether you are a beginner or an expert, there is a language on this list for you. Learning one or more of these languages will help you stay ahead of the curve and advance your career in software engineering and cloud computing. So, what are you waiting for? Start learning today!

Editor Recommended Sites

AI and Tech News
Best Online AI Courses
Classic Writing Analysis
Tears of the Kingdom Roleplay
Neo4j App: Neo4j tutorials for graph app deployment
Crypto Tax - Tax management for Crypto Coinbase / Binance / Kraken: Learn to pay your crypto tax and tax best practice round cryptocurrency gains
Switch Tears of the Kingdom fan page: Fan page for the sequal to breath of the wild 2
Games Like ...: Games similar to your favorite games you like
JavaFX Tips: JavaFX tutorials and best practice